Philadelphia’s Restrictions on Pre-Employment Marijuana Tests Become Effective January 1, 2022

Beginning January 1, 2022, the majority of employers in Philadelphia will be prohibited from requiring prospective employees to undergo testing for the presence of marijuana as a condition of employment. New York City and Nevada have similar laws in place and others are expected to follow. Exceptions apply to individuals applying to work in law enforcement positions; any position requiring a commercial driver’s license; any position requiring the supervision or care of children, medical patients, disabled or other vulnerable individuals; and any position in which the employee could significantly impact the health or safety of other employees or members of the public.
